Having just experienced major problems with my Mac OS X installation, I thought I should invest in a decent backup solution (yes, I don't have any form of backup solution at the moment!).

I have a 40 Gb IDE hard drive with 5 Gb used. I'm wondering what solutions people can recommend for such a setup.

I was thinking along the lines of:
1. an external USB drive for slow overnight backups
2. another internal IDE drive equivalent in size to the first so that i could just duplicate the data on the second drive.
3. a massive form of removable storage. I'm looking for recommendations in this respect...

I use FoldersSynchronizer. I am not using it on X though. I am using 9.1 and it works well.

I have used retrospect in the past and found this adequate, but I think in X it will only work in client mode (meaning you will have to backup to a machine that is using a non-X environment).
